Holiday Rental for Groups of Families and Friends. Mount Vernon, New Quay, Burren, County Clare, Ireland, sleeps 5 - 11 in 5 bedrooms.

This is a dream location, Mount Vernon is a beach front holiday house in County Clare overlooking stunning views of Galway Bay and the Cliffs of Aughinish. All that lies between the house and the sea is a beautiful wildflower meadow. It really doesn't get much more perfect. Groups of friends and multi generation families will love coming here to celebrate a special birthday or to enjoy an idyllic holiday literally on the sea front. There are walks from the door to take in the incredible natural landscape of the Flaggy Shore.

Mount Vernon has an interesting history and retains many original features including high ceilings, cornices and sash windows while offering comfortable accommodation with all mod cons. A range cooker in the farmhouse kitchen is great for preparing group meals and the formal dining area a fantastic space to enjoy suppers together. Use the smaller table and island in the kitchen for breakfast or enjoy a barbecue on the terrace in the gorgeous walled garden admiring the Monterey Cypress trees and herbaceous borders. The sitting room with squashy sofas and a roaring open fire is the place to retire to after dinner for a night cap, surrounded by stunning period furniture and lots of books from the library. On a nice evening, sit outside next to the firepit and listen to the gentle lapping of the waves on the shore sharing a bottle of wine or a drink from the bar.

All of the bedrooms are elegantly decorated with luxurious soft furnishings and en suites. The 3 upstairs bedrooms boast sea views and those on the ground floor garden views. The ground floor rooms might be suitable for anyone less mobile in a 3 generation party, these rooms have French door access to the terrace for the first coffee of the day.

If the kids ever get tired of playing on the beach there are plenty of other attractions to visit nearby including the Burrenbeo Trust and Ailwee Caves. The Cliffs of Moher are definitely worth the 50 minute drive to witness spectacular rugged coastal formations described as the 8th Wonder of the World. Kinvarra is a pretty fishing village known for artisan shops and cute cafes.

Facilities

WiFi

WiFi is available throughout the property.

Disabled Facilities

None specified but there are ground floor bedrooms with en suite facilities.

Dog Friendly

Pets welcome.

Kitchen

A well equipped spacious country kitchen has all appliances including a range cooker, dishwasher, microwave, freezer, washing machine and dryer.

Dining Room

Formal dining area for all guests with sea views. Informal dining in kitchen. Al fresco meals on the terrace with seating.

Sitting Room

Large lounge with plenty of sofas and an open fire. Library area.

TV and Music Facilities

A 32” television with Netflix, and a smart home system including Alexa.

Games Room

There is no games room.

Heating and Open Fires

Central heating. Open fire in the lounge.

Bedrooms

2 superkings, 1 king, 1 double, 1 double with a single. All en suite. 3 upstairs and 2 downstairs.

Linen

Bed linen and bathroom towels are provided.

Bathrooms

Contemporary bathrooms with baths and overhead shower. Voya products provided.

Children's Facilities

None specific.

Outdoor

Beach front property. Inner courtyard and terrace, outdoor seating, walled garden and herbaceous borders.

Swimming Pool

There is no pool.

Parking

Plenty of off road secure parking.

Smoking

No smoking please.

Booking Information

A 20% deposit is required when booking and the final payment is 14 days prior to arrival. A €400 damage deposit is taken with final payment and refunded 2 days after departure. Check in after 4PM/Check out by 10AM. Minimum stay 3 nights, 7 nights in July/August. Dog friendly. No smoking please.

Location

Located on the Flaggy Shore in the region of Burren on the Wild Atlantic Way and 50 minute drive to Galway. Limerick is just over an hour away, Dublin 2 hours 40 minutes. Accessed via the N67 and M18.

  • Kinvarra and Ballyvaughan.
  • Oranmore(36 minutes), Galway(50 minutes), Gort (28 minutes) train station.
  • Kinvarra and Ballyvaughan are both a 15 minute drive.
  • Kinvarra has a Spar Supermarket and a Mace. Oranmore has a large Tesco. Galway has a Dunnes, M&S, Tesco.
  • Russell's Art Gallery and cafe is a 10 minute walk. Linnane's Lobster Bar is a 15 minute walk. Fresh fish within 15 minute walk. Ballyvaughan has Monks, Snug Bar and Green's Bar.  
  • Shannon (56 minutes).
